Beyond the Basic Loop: Creative Sampler Techniques

Stepping outside the confines of a basic sampler loop opens up a realm of sonic possibilities. Experiment with stutter effects to add rhythmic complexity and textural depth to your samples. Cascade multiple samples together, manipulating their timing and pitch to create lush, evolving soundscapes. Don't be afraid to warp your samples through filters to unearth unexpected textures and timbres. The key is to constantly explore, experiment, and embrace the unpredictable nature of sampling.

  • Consider using a sampler with intuitive controls for finer adjustment of your samples.
  • Blend live instruments or field recordings into your sampler loops for an added dimension of organic feel.
  • Explore rhythmic patterns within your samples to create unique melodies and rhythms.

Crafting the Perfect Sampler Loop

Layering sounds in music production is a delicate dance. A seamless sampler loop is essential for creating rich, textured soundscapes without any jarring transitions. It's about blending audio elements so they flow together naturally, crafting a cohesive whole from individual parts. The process involves careful attention to timing, pitch, and volume.

Start by choosing samples that complement each other in feel. Next, experiment with different looping points to find the most natural transition. Utilize minor adjustments to pitch and tempo to create a sense of movement and complexity. Automation can also be utilized to subtly modulate parameters over time, adding another layer of refinement to your loop. Remember, the goal is to create a sonic experience that feels effortless, transporting the listener on an auditory journey.
